导读就爱阅读网友为您分享以下“ORACLE中 refcursor,refcursor与sy资讯希望对您有所帮助感谢您对92to.com的支持!
1.ref cursor
当需要将游标与不同的查询语句建立关联时需要使用游标变量游标变量是一种引用类型相当于C语言的指针属于动态cursor即直到运行时才知道这条查询。
在使用游标变量之前首先声明该变量。
格式如下type ref_cursor_type_name is ref cursor [return
1
return_type]ref_cursor_type_name是引用类型的名字 return_type是说明最终被该游标变量的返回类型。游标变量的返回类型必须是记录类型。curso声明游标变量
为查询打开游标变量 open cursor_variale forselect_statement
关闭游标变量 close curso
注意
游标类型本身可以在包中定义但是游标变量不能在包中定义。
游标变量可以在客户端与服务器之间传递但不能在两个服务器之间传递。
2
不能通过动态SQL使用游标变量
PL/SQL的inde x-by表嵌套表和可变数组不能存储游标变量表和视图也不能存储ref cursor引用类型的列
能使用静态游标最好不要用ref游标
2.sys_refcursor和refcursorsys_refcursor是oracle9i以后系统定义的一个refcursor,主要用在过程中返回结果集。
例如create or replace procedure xyy_proc(cur outsys_refcurso r)
3
asbeg inopen curfor select*from emp;end xyy_proc;
在客户端:var CUR refcursor;exec xyy_proc(:cur);
百度搜索“就爱阅读”,专业资料,生活学习,尽在就爱阅读网92to.com,您的在线图书馆
4
Digital-vm是一家成立于2019年的国外主机商,商家提供VPS和独立服务器租用业务,其中VPS基于KVM架构,提供1-10Gbps带宽,数据中心可选包括美国洛杉矶、日本、新加坡、挪威、西班牙、丹麦、荷兰、英国等8个地区机房;除了VPS主机外,商家还提供日本、新加坡独立服务器,同样可选1-10Gbps带宽,最低每月仅80美元起。下面列出两款独立服务器配置信息。配置一 $80/月CPU:E3-...
今天看到一个网友从原来虚拟主机准备转移至服务器管理自己的业务。这里问到虚拟主机和服务器到底有什么不同,需要用到哪些工具软件。那准备在下班之间稍微摸鱼一下整理我们服务器安装环境和运维管理中常见需要用到的软件工具推荐。第一、系统镜像软件一般来说,我们云服务器或者独立服务器都是有自带镜像的。我们只需要选择镜像安装就可以,比如有 Windows和Linux。但是有些时候我们可能需要自定义镜像的高级玩法,这...
Virmach对资源限制比较严格,建议查看TOS,自己做好限制,优点是稳定。 vCPU 内存 空间 流量 带宽 IPv4 价格 购买 1 512MB 15GB SSD 500GB 1Gbps 1 $7/VirMach:$7/年/512MB内存/15GB SSD空间/500GB流量/1Gbps端口/KVM/洛杉矶/西雅图/芝加哥/纽约等 发布于 5个月前 (01-05) VirMach,美国老牌、稳...